吾是土豆泥
选择PHP课程在同行业中占有独特的优势的机构,目前学习php的学生很多,应用范围很广。对于找工作是需要看自身学习程度来确定,可以先看一些相关视频教程学习,这是很有帮助,也能学到很多。
转瞬壹刻
在ResultSet对象里面,我们找不到取得结果行数的办法。 其实我们通常的解决方法无非有一下几种:上海php培训 [1] Connection con=.... Statement stmt = (); String sqlStr = "count(*) as total "; ResultSet rst = (sqlStr); (); int total = ("total"); 缺点:如果想要遍历结果集,你不得不在执行一次查询,取得结果集。 [2] String accQrySql = "select * from accounts"; Connection con = (); Statement stmt = (); ResultSet rst = (accQrySql); 你可以通过下面的方法来取得结果集的记录数目 (); int total = (); 这时,你可以取得记录数目。 如果 while(()){ ........ } int total = (); 你将得到的total是0 因为,getRow是在遍历结果集的时候的指针,也是在结果集内移动的指针,也就是说,指向了当前的记录索引号,所以,在进行结果集的遍历前和后都被重置成0。 所以,想取得记录的条数,可以把指针移到最后一条记录,然后取得当前记录的编号就是记录的条数。 所以,必须用 (); 之后才能用 ()来取得,才能取到值。 注意:想要用这种方法来取得结果集的行数,必须用 可滚动结果集 Statement stmt = (); 否则,你就不能执行 () 也就不能取得结果集的条数。上海计算机培训之java培训、上海php培训找最专业的上海IT培训机构上海达内。!
优质考试培训问答知识库